This article explores the important role of a lawyer in resolving legal disputes and highlights the key responsibilities they have in the legal system. A lawyer plays a crucial role in resolving legal disputes and ensuring that justice is served. They are legal professionals who are trained to provide legal advice and representation to individuals, businesses, and organizations. Lawyers have a deep understanding of the law and legal procedures, which enables them to navigate the complexities of the legal system on behalf of their clients. One of the key responsibilities of a lawyer is to advocate for their clients in court. This involves presenting legal arguments, cross-examining witnesses, and negotiating with opposing counsel to reach a favorable outcome for their clients. Lawyers must also conduct thorough research and analysis of legal issues to build a strong case on behalf of their clients. In addition to representing clients in court, lawyers also play a crucial role in providing legal advice and guidance. They help clients understand their legal rights and obligations, and provide guidance on how to navigate the legal system. Lawyers also draft legal documents, such as contracts and wills, to ensure that their clients\ interests are protected. Furthermore, lawyers are often involved in alternative dispute resolution methods, such as mediation and arbitration, to help clients resolve legal disputes outside of court. These methods can be more cost-effective and efficient than going to trial, and lawyers play a key role in facilitating negotiations and reaching a settlement that is acceptable to all parties involved. In conclusion, lawyers play a vital role in resolving legal disputes and ensuring that justice is served. Their expertise, advocacy skills, and legal knowledge are essential in navigating the complexities of the legal system and achieving favorable outcomes for their clients.
